Combine the first 3 ingredients; sprinkle on both sides of steaks.
Combine egg and milk in a shallow bowl.
Dip steaks in egg mixture, then dredge in cracker crumbs.
Pour oil to depth of 1/2 inch into large, heavy skillet.
Fry steaks in hot oil over medium heat until brown, turning once.
Remove steaks; drain off drippings, reserving 3 tablespoons.
In skillet, add flour, stirring until smooth.
Cook 1 minute.
Add broth and 1/2 cup milk; stir constantly until thick.
Add Worcestershire sauce; stir.
Serve gravy with steaks and cooked rice or mashed potatoes.
